angular - 动态更改 socketio 配置
问题描述
我在 Angular 应用程序中使用 ngx-socket-io 进行实时通知
我目前的要求是仅在设置数据库中启用通知或 socketio 请求到服务器
我正在考虑通过在运行时更改 socketio 模块配置来进行此更改,即当我从 API 调用获取设置时。
我在 app.module 中的当前代码:
if(environment.angularEnv == "local") {
config = { url: 'http://localhost:8001', options: {} };
} else {
config = { url: location.origin, options: {} };
}
imports: [
BrowserModule,
SocketIoModule.forRoot(config),
解决方案
推荐阅读
- c# - Unity3d:获取平行于平面的方向向量
- python - 带有 ANSI 转义的 Python `doctest`
- node.js - 更新 Telegram 机器人中的消息
- scala - 模拟播放 api 请求失败
- dotnetnuke - 在 DNN 菜单中显示 IconFile
- excel - 切片器修改属性
- asp.net-core - System.Security.Principal.WindowsIdentity.GetCurrent().Name vs User.Identity.Name 我应该使用哪一个?
- python - 如何使用 GNURadio 处理 Python 块中的输入和输出样本数?
- php - coinbase api 通知中的 $_SERVER['HTTP_CB_SIGNATURE'] 是什么?
- wpf - 自定义项控制方法